Saturday, February 22, 2003, 10:31:32 AM, Robert wrote:

RCW> I want to get rid of the 'ok', in the Subject line. TIA for any
RCW> suggestions.

Go to the Popfile Control Center and click on the "configuration" tab.
Find the item that says "subject line modification" and switch the
option to off.
